Table 2.
Radiologic findings and laboratory results.
| Value | |
|---|---|
| Radiologic finding | |
| Abnormalities on chest CT, n (%) | 14/16 |
| Negative for pneumonia | 2 |
| Indeterminate for COVID-19 (consistent) | 5 |
| Atypical pattern of COVID-19 | 3 |
| Typical for COVID-19 | 6 |
| Laboratory findingsa, b, median (range) | |
| CRP level, mg/L, n = 26 | 68.5 (0.5–485) |
| PCT level, ng/mL, n = 17 | 1.65 (0.03–448) |
| Lymphocyte counts per mm3, n = 24 | 1850 (100–4700) |
| Neutrophil count, × per mm3, n = 25 | 6500 (100–21800) |
| Fibrinogen level, g/L, n = 17 | 4.6 (2.7–8.6) |
| D-dimer level, ng/mL, n = 15 | 2036 (215–23,611) |
| Creatinine level, μmol/L, n = 23 | 42 (13–144) |
| ALT level, U/L, n = 22 | 26 (6–4300) |
ALT: alanine aminotransferase; CRP: C-reactive protein; CT: computed tomography; PCT: procalcitonin.
Some data on biological findings are missing.
Worst values during the stay.
